Guard

(noun) A person who, or thing that, protects or watches over something. Example: "The prison guard unlocked the door of the cell.   After completing the repairs, he replaced the sump guard."

"Guard well your spare moments. They are like uncut diamonds. Discard them and their value will never be known. Improve them and they will become the brightest gems in a useful life."
— Ralph Waldo Emerson
"Always acknowledge a fault. This will throw those in authority off their guard and give you an opportunity to commit more."
— Mark Twain
"I'm one of those people who fiercely guards their privacy, so I hate doing interviews."
— Megan Fox
"Guard against the impostures of pretended patriotism."
— George Washington
"Be vigilant; guard your mind against negative thoughts."
— Gautama Buddha
